Mode of Gate Operation  

 

The gate motor is supplied in MANUAL mode as standard. 

 
Manual Release Mechanism 
The manual release mechanism is located at the front of the motor. To access the manual 
release mechanism you will need the key for the lock and the hex key that was supplied with the 
SL gate motor kit to engage or release the clutch. 
 
Manual Mode 
Put the key in the keyhole and turn to the key in the “Open” direction as shown by the arrow on 
the cover to open the hole for the hex key. Insert the hex key into the hole and turn it in the 
“Open” direction until you can freely move the motor drive gear and / or gate freely by hand. 
 
Automatic Mode 
Insert the key in the keyhole and turn the key in the “Open” direction as shown by the arrow on 
the cover to open the hole for the hex key. Insert the hex key into the hole and turn it in the 
“Close” direction until it tightens and the motor drive gear is fully engaged and you can not rotate 
the drive gear or move the gate freely by hand. Rock the drive gear or gate backwards and 
forward the ensure the clutch is correctly engaged. Remove the hex key and turn the lock in the 
“Close” direction and remove the lock key.
